Speakers
Andrew Kennedy - Blockchain Application Management with Hyperledger and Docker using Cloudsoft AMP.
Andrew will show how the Hyperledger project can be deployed and managed on Docker containers, using Cloudsoft AMP, and will give a short demo of the Hyperledger blockchain application.
He Jingkai - Running untrusted code in the browser using Docker containers.
Jingkai is a product engineer working for FreeAgent. He is going to give a talk about his Koderunr project, which allows untrusted code to be run in browser and cli powered by Go and Docker. In this talk Jingkai will first give a live demo and show how to get Koderunr up and running using Go and Docker, then discuss the choices between Docker clients and how to secure the Docker-based service and the SSE (Server-Sent Events) technology used for streaming.
